Pre-Trade Preparation

Before the trade, make sure you are fully prepared. This includes verifying the buyer’s identity, understanding the agreed-upon price, and setting clear expectations. Preparation reduces misunderstandings and potential disputes.

Verify Buyer Identity

Ask for a valid ID or other proof of identity. This helps confirm the buyer’s legitimacy and reduces the risk of scams.

Agree on Payment Method and Amount

Clearly specify the exact amount and the form of cash accepted. Confirm that both parties agree on the terms before proceeding.

During the Trade

During the exchange, follow safety protocols and be vigilant to prevent fraud or theft. Keep the transaction transparent and secure.

Choose a Safe Location

Meet in a public, well-lit area such as a coffee shop or a busy parking lot. Avoid secluded places to reduce risk.

Count Cash Carefully

Count the cash in front of the buyer to confirm the amount matches the agreed price. Use a calculator if needed to avoid mistakes.

Check for Counterfeit Bills

Inspect the bills for authenticity using a counterfeit detection pen or UV light. Be cautious with large denominations.

Post-Trade Actions

After completing the trade, take steps to document the transaction and ensure everything is in order.

Document the Transaction

Keep a record of the trade, including the amount exchanged, date, location, and buyer details. This can be useful for future reference or disputes.

Secure the Funds

Deposit the cash into a bank account promptly or store it securely if immediate deposit isn’t possible. Avoid carrying large sums unnecessarily.

Additional Tips for Safe Transactions

  • Trust your instincts—if something feels off, reconsider the trade.
  • Bring a friend or inform someone about your location and the details of the trade.
  • Use a counterfeit detection tool to verify bills.
  • Avoid accepting cash from unfamiliar or suspicious buyers.
  • Be cautious of overly eager buyers or those who rush the process.
